The Administrative Litigation Courtroom of Appeals suspended the momentary constructing code for the five-kilometer buffer zone across the Ostional Nationwide Wildlife Refuge (RNVSO- Refugio Nacional de Vida Silvestre de Ostional), the conservation web site the place 1000’s of turtles lay their eggs yearly.
The Courtroom argued that the Municipality of Nicoya ought to base itself on the legal guidelines of the Nationwide Institute of Housing and Urbanism (INVU) to manage “tasks which can be thought to threaten the environmental steadiness ultimately” till the lawsuit is resolved. The judges additionally supported their determination on the truth that the Ostional Wildlife Refuge Law and its basic administration plan (which has not but been made official resulting from authorized obstacles) present a framework to make sure the safety of the refuge.
“The safety of the Ostional Wildlife Refuge, as a part of the general public curiosity represented by the safety of the surroundings, derives from the legislation that shaped it and associated legal guidelines which have sought to safe the world in accordance with the provisions of article 1 of Law 9348 of March 2, 2016,” the court docket identified.
The judges additionally accepted the argument of the plaintiff, lodge and actual property businessman Jeff Glosshandler, who indicated that he has three properties within the buffer zone, so the code would impose limitations on transformation, funding and capital beneficial properties enhance.
The Nosara Civic Affiliation (NCA) proposed the code to the Municipality of Nicoya in 2019. RNVSO helps each entities in implementing the code. They’re opposed by Jeff Glosshandler via the corporate JBR Capital Ventures, which he manages.
The court docket’s determination is a part of the authorized swimsuit that JBR Capital Ventures filed in opposition to the Municipality of Nicoya, believing that the regulation violates enough procedures to manage development. In keeping with Glosshandlier, the regulatory plan needs to be published to define construction limitations.

Glosshandler filed the lawsuit in opposition to the Municipality of Nicoya two months after the constructing code was formalized in February 2020. The businessman requested that the rules be briefly annulled as a precautionary measure till the Administrative Litigation Courtroom renders a call on the lawsuit. The court docket rejected the petition, bearing in mind that the corporate’s curiosity “can not undermine the general public curiosity concerned within the species’ safety.”
Nevertheless, the Administrative Litigation Courtroom of Appeals determined in favor of Glosshandler after his attraction, so the code will not be in power briefly till the court docket decides on the lawsuit. The ultimate decree can take greater than a yr.
“Having that response from the courts was very shocking, particularly since we already had a positive manifestation of a collective curiosity, not an financial one,” remarked RNVSO’s supervisor.
For his half, Carvajal mentioned that he didn’t count on the court docket to determine on the phrases that it did. “We imagine that the important necessities to approve the measure on the requested phrases weren’t met,” he instructed The Voice.

Why a Constructing Code?
The code would management the expansion of development in RNVSO’s buffer zone till the municipality finalizes and publishes the regulatory plan, a municipal doc just like a zoning plan that determines land use. (Learn -in Spanish- the momentary regulation beginning on page 53 of this document).
In March, the mayor of Nicoya, Carlos Armando Martinez, mentioned that they’re within the part of research vital for making the regulatory plan, and that it could take as much as 4 years to finalize and publish it.
“The research are very costly, whether or not they’re achieved with our personal assets or not…. The utmost assist from me is that the funds will get created and that [the regulatory plan] is made within the subsequent 4 years,” he added.
Given how lengthy it’s taking to make the plan, the NCA proposed the momentary constructing code to the municipality, which took it on and labored on it for greater than a yr within the municipal council’s regulatory plan fee and in actions within the district of Nosara.
With the doc as a instrument, the municipality restricted the dimensions of buildings, the development space in line with the full land space, the disposal of sewage and the route of lighting so it doesn’t disorient the turtles, all with the objective of preserving the habitat of the 1000’s of turtles that come to put their eggs at Ostional Seaside in addition to the water tables positioned within the buffer zone.

“This code tried to determine accountable improvement to keep away from what has occurred in locations like Playa Grande, the place turtles arrive much less and fewer because of the [light] air pollution attributable to Tamarindo’s lighting,” Cedeño, from RNVSO, cited for instance.
In keeping with the coordinator of the native authorities’s development division, Josue Ruiz, the code going into power wasn’t creating conflicts with builders who offered constructing permits.
“I can say that we’ve detected issues with the peak of the plans or the occupancy dimension in lower than 5 circumstances within the space,” he instructed The Voice of Guanacaste in March, after making use of the code for a yr. “We’re speaking about perhaps 500 constructing permits the place solely 5 have been the issue. It’s little or no,” he indicated.
Nevertheless, Glosshandler claimed that due process wasn’t followed for the temporary code to go into effect. Previous to its publication, this businessman and his crew— which additionally contains former Congressman Otto Guevara Guth— went to the municipal council to point out their opposition to the code.
“I’m not against there being restrictions on peak or development areas,” he mentioned in a letter to the editor in Semanario Universidad. “However these needs to be in accordance with the realities of actions within the space, the probabilities of locals to satisfy the prices and the results of a participatory course of,” he wrote.
